谈谈网页设计中的字体应用Font Set

网络推广 2025-04-16 09:23www.168986.cn网络推广竞价

关于网页字体选择的奥秘

大家好!近期,网页字体选择问题被频繁提及。虽然这是一个看似不大的问题,但在前端开发中具有基础性的重要地位。毕竟,网页的主要内容还是以文字信息为主,而字体作为文字表现形式的重要参数,自然有着举足轻重的地位。遗憾的是,字体的重要性长时间被忽视。

很多人对字体的理解还停留在简单的 font-family 设定上,如 "宋体", Arial, Helvetica, serif 等,却鲜少思考为何要如此设定,这样的设定是否合理。今天,就让我来介绍字体的来龙去脉。

我们知道在CSS规则中,字体的定义是通过 font-family 实现的。但翻阅CSS文档,我们会发现并没有任何规则能指定某一特定字体。

回想十年前,我们经常在网页上看到这样的代码:

Lorem Ipsum

很少有人考虑到,像Frankin Gothic Book这种字体是Windows专属的。在Mac上,因为系统找不到这种字体,就会改用默认字体显示,导致网页风格大变,完全达不到预期效果。W3C提出了font set的概念——将一系列近似字体按照优先级顺序组成列表。浏览器会从列表头部开始匹配,找到第一个可用的字体并显示。

以之前的例子来说,我们可以创建一个这样的font set:

Lorem Ipsum

那么浏览器呈现文字的方式会是这样的:在Windows下使用Frankin Gothic Book显示;在Mac下则先搜索Frankin Gothic Book,如果不存在则搜索Lucida Grande,若仍不存在则使用默认的sans-serif字体显示。这样确保了文字在所有设备上都能得到良好的展示效果。

正确选择和使用网页字体对于确保文字的一致性和网页的美观性至关重要。希望这篇文章能帮助大家更好地理解字体的奥秘并正确应用到网页设计中去。下一个字体之星:Lucida Grande之旅

随着系统的呼唤,某浏览器开始启动字体搜索之旅。它首先寻找的是Frankin Gothic Book字体,系统并未找到这个字体,搜索宣告失败。浏览器并未放弃,继续寻找下一个目标——Lucida Grande字体。幸运的是,这次搜索成功,浏览器找到了Lucida Grande字体并决定使用它来显示接下来的内容。在这个过程中,我们看到了一种不断和寻找最佳选择的努力,这也如同设计师们在选择字体时的过程。

关于字体的选择和应用,我们需要了解两点重要的内容。第一点关于通用字体族。在字体列表中没有特定匹配项时,浏览器会自动寻找通用字体族来替代。通用字体族是一种备选方案,当其他所有字体都无效时才会被启用。例如,上面的例子中浏览器指定Arial为sans-serif字体,但在其他浏览器中可能选择Helvetica作为备选。这意味着我们无法预知具体哪个字体将被最终应用。在设计过程中,设计师应该尽可能地提供完整的字体集,以覆盖尽可能多的系统环境,而不是依赖通用字体族。这是因为通用字体族的适用性和美观性可能并不如特定的定制字体。在设计时,我们需要尽可能地考虑到这些因素,以确保我们的设计能够在各种环境下都能展现出最佳的效果。设计师们在设计过程中需要充分了解字体的特性以及浏览器的应用规则,以确保设计作品在各种环境中都能保持其一致性和美观性。通用字体族的使用也存在一些误区和注意事项。比如上述例子中的两种写法就是错误的示例。我们需要明确指定字体的规则和应用顺序,否则可能会出现指定字体未匹配就直接使用通用字体的错误情况。这将影响到设计作品的最终呈现效果和设计意图的实现。总之设计师们在设计和制作过程中应该充分了解和遵守这些规则以确保我们的作品能够展现出最佳的效果和用户体验。同时我们也需要认识到浏览器应用字体的规则虽然看似简单实则十分复杂需要我们不断学习和以便更好地应用到设计中去今天我们就先到这里让我们期待下一次关于通用字体族的深入讨论吧。让我们共同期待下一次的之旅吧!在未来的文章中我们将更深入地这些话题帮助大家更好地理解并应用这些知识为设计带来更多的可能性和创造力!最后让我们一起欣赏并使用那些独具魅力的字体现成的创作灵感吧!在未来的旅程中让我们共同字体的奥秘感受设计的魅力创造无限可能!今天我们就先告一段落下次我们再继续深入通用字体族的奥秘!让我们共同期待下一次的精彩讨论吧!再见!再见!再见!再见!再见!再见!Cambrian渲染完成!

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by